Juab plays host to Springville in the other league tussle, khile Tintic draws the bye. Provo high school opens its Big Nine season with a home date a-gainst a-gainst the highly touted East high Leopards, who have piled up the best pre-season record of any of the Big Nine schools. The Bulldogs have been improving steadily, however, how-ever, and promise to give the vis- . itors a tough ball game. The power-packed East squad has been turning in wins handily over most of their opponents this year, and except for a loss to the powerful Box Elder Bees, have a great record this season. The Lincoln American Fork tussle looks to be pretty much in favor of the red-clad Cavemen. The Forkers have had only one bad night in their preseason games, : that against Springville, where they won by 3 points, and have stamped themselves already as an , outstanding contender for the state . wide honors that they almost cop- , ped last year. Lincoln has a very respectable record and a good crew, but are not given much chance with the Durrant-Feters wrecking crew. Discounting the fact that American Amer-ican Fork's record puts them head and shoulders above every team in the division, the other four crews are pretty evenly matched, and the game between Lehi and rieasant Grove shows promise of developing into one really good scrap.
